Overview:

The mission of the Hematology Division of Brigham and Women's Hospital (BWH) is to provide advanced clinical care, teaching, and research in hematology. As part of the multidisciplinary Dana-Farber Brigham Cancer Center, we are one of the largest centers for adults with blood and bone marrow diseases in the world with more than 20 clinical hematology specialists, nurse practitioners and social workers, providing comprehensive, personalized care to our patients.

Under the direction and supervision of the Administrative Manager, the administrative staff functions as the overall resource for clinicians and nurse practitioners, providing clerical and scheduling support, and acts as the primary interface between the patient and the provider.

Administrative staff maintains a hybrid work schedule (3 days on-site, 2 days remote). The hours for this position are 8:30am to 5:00pm, Monday through Friday.

General Responsibilities:

  • Performs administrative duties under minimal supervision at the highest proficiency level.
  • Handles all aspects of patient appointment scheduling for Dana Farber Cancer Institute (DFCI) / Faulkner Hospital / BWH Hematology patients (i.e.: provider visits, labs, infusions, imaging, biopsies, etc.).
  • Manages provider's clinic schedules, closures, and rescheduling.
  • Works closely with DFCI Anticoagulation Management Service to maintain patient database, coordinate testing, retrieve results, and send out correspondence.
  • Ensures lab tests are scheduled and ordered appropriately; coordinates the retrieval of tests results and acts as point-person for patient testing logistics.
  • Submits and tracks prior authorizations.
  • Answers and triages incoming telephone calls in a professional and courteous manner, forwarding appropriate messages and making proper referrals.
  • Drafts, proofreads, and sends out appointment reminder letters, provider notes, emails, patient portal message, and other written correspondence on behalf of providers; responds to routine requests for letters, forms and other information from patients and referring providers.
  • Follows HIPAA guidelines for the management of patient privacy and confidentiality.
  • Performs routine office tasks, such as telephone coverage, filing, sending and receiving faxes, ordering office supplies, sorting mail, etc.
  • Provides cross coverage as needed and performs other tasks as requested.
